ABSTRACT:
The present invention provides a method and device for ascertaining flow rate of a fluid based on measured values of the upstream fluid total-pressure and static-pressure measured downstream the entrance of a flow constricting member, such as an orifice plate, a flow nozzle or a venturi. According to principles set forth herein, this parameter allows simplification of flow rate determinations for both compressible and incompressible fluids. As a result, significant computational advantages may be achieved in comparison with the prior art. In presently preferred embodiments, a first pressure sensor means for detecting the upstream total fluid pressure includes a pitot-tube fluid-pressure sensor. In order to determine fluid density, a temperature probe may be provided to detect total temperature at the stagnation point created by the pitot tube. A second pressure sensor is also provided to detect the desired downstream static fluid pressure. A flowmeter constructed according to the invention further includes a suitable processor for receiving the measured information and determining flow rate based thereon.
